ESP: Nastavení IDE

Z MiS
(Rozdíly mezi verzemi)
Přejít na: navigace, hledání
(Doplněno stažení ovladače USB2.0-Serial.)
(Pokud nefunguje stažení aktuální verze, použijte starší.)
 
(Nejsou zobrazeny 2 mezilehlé verze od 1 uživatele.)
Řádka 17: Řádka 17:
 
#* ''... Čekejte, i docela dlouho, než se načte seznam desek... ;)''
 
#* ''... Čekejte, i docela dlouho, než se načte seznam desek... ;)''
 
#* Hledat "esp"
 
#* Hledat "esp"
#* Instalovat ''esp8266 by ESP8266 Community'' (cca 150 MB)
+
#* Instalovat ''esp8266 by ESP8266 Community'' (cca 150 MB) — vyberte poslední verzi.
 +
#*: Pokud se instalace nedaří, zkuste v předchozím kroku nastavit odkaz na starší verzi knihovny, například:
 +
#*: <code>https:<!-- -->//github.com/esp8266/Arduino/releases/download/2.7.0/package_esp8266com_index.json</code>
 +
#*: Čísla verzí najdete v&nbsp;rozbalovacím seznamu hned vedle tlačítka "Instalovat".
 
# Volba devboardu
 
# Volba devboardu
 
#* V našem případě ''DevBoard NodeMCU 1.0'':<br /><code>Nástroje &rarr; Vývojová deska... &rarr; NodeMCU 1.0 (ESP-12E)</code>
 
#* V našem případě ''DevBoard NodeMCU 1.0'':<br /><code>Nástroje &rarr; Vývojová deska... &rarr; NodeMCU 1.0 (ESP-12E)</code>
Řádka 27: Řádka 30:
 
#* <code>Nástroje &rarr; Programátor &rarr; USB tiny ISP</code>
 
#* <code>Nástroje &rarr; Programátor &rarr; USB tiny ISP</code>
  
== Problém: Nefunguje USB &rarr; Seriál ==
+
== Problém: Nefunguje převodník USB2.0-Serial ==
 
; Problém
 
; Problém
 
* Po připojení devboardu se neobjeví nový port.
 
* Po připojení devboardu se neobjeví nový port.
* Ve Správci zařízení ve Windows se zobrazí Další zařízení s názvem „USB2.0-Serial“, které nemá ovladače.
+
* Ve ''Správci zařízení'' ve Windows se v&nbsp;sekci ''Další zařízení'' zobrazí zařízení s názvem ''USB2.0-Serial'', které nemá ovladače.
 
; Řešení?
 
; Řešení?
* Stáhněte a nainstalujte ovladač ze stránek: [http://www.wch.cn/download/CH341SER_ZIP.html http://www.wch.cn/download/CH341SER_ZIP.html].
+
* Stáhněte a rozbalte ovladač ze stránek: [http://www.wch.cn/download/CH341SER_ZIP.html http://www.wch.cn/download/CH341SER_ZIP.html].
 +
* Ve ''Správci zařízení'' klikněte na zařízení, zvolte ''Aktualizovat ovladač...'' a vyberte složku s&nbsp;rozbaleným ovladačem.
 +
* Zařízení by mělo zmizet ze sekce ''Další zařízení'' a&nbsp;v&nbsp;seznamu portů by se měl objevit další sériový port.
  
 
== Zdroje ==
 
== Zdroje ==
 
* Návod: [http://arduinesp.com/getting-started Arduinesp.com &rarr; Getting Started]
 
* Návod: [http://arduinesp.com/getting-started Arduinesp.com &rarr; Getting Started]
 
* Instalace pluginu: [https://learn.sparkfun.com/tutorials/esp8266-thing-hookup-guide/installing-the-esp8266-arduino-addon Learn.Sparkfun.com &rarr; Installing the ESP8266 Arduino AddOn]
 
* Instalace pluginu: [https://learn.sparkfun.com/tutorials/esp8266-thing-hookup-guide/installing-the-esp8266-arduino-addon Learn.Sparkfun.com &rarr; Installing the ESP8266 Arduino AddOn]

Aktuální verze z 18. 6. 2020, 09:19


Instalace a nastavení vývojového prostředí Arduino IDE

Doporučujeme spustit klasický instalátor, ne jen rozbalit prostředí Arduino IDE z archivu!

Součástí instalace prostředí Arduino IDE je i instalace USB Driveru (převodník USB→serial). Pokud nemáte možnost spustit instalaci (nejste správce počítače), budete muset tento driver doinstalovat dodatečně.

  1. Instalace Arduino IDE
    • Stažení instalátoru: www.Arduino.cc
    • Součástí instalace je i instalace Arduino USB driveru!
  2. Vložení odkazu na knihovku s balíčky pro ESP8266
  3. Instalace balíčku pro ESP8266
    • Nástroje → Vývojová deska → Manažer desek...
    • ... Čekejte, i docela dlouho, než se načte seznam desek... ;)
    • Hledat "esp"
    • Instalovat esp8266 by ESP8266 Community (cca 150 MB) — vyberte poslední verzi.
      Pokud se instalace nedaří, zkuste v předchozím kroku nastavit odkaz na starší verzi knihovny, například:
      https://github.com/esp8266/Arduino/releases/download/2.7.0/package_esp8266com_index.json
      Čísla verzí najdete v rozbalovacím seznamu hned vedle tlačítka "Instalovat".
  4. Volba devboardu
    • V našem případě DevBoard NodeMCU 1.0:
      Nástroje → Vývojová deska... → NodeMCU 1.0 (ESP-12E)
  5. Volba virtuálního sériového portu (pokud máte devboard připojen přes USB kabel):
    • Nástroje → Port COM... ... podívejte se na seznam portů
    • Připojte DevBoard USB kabelem
    • Nástroje → Port COM... ... Zvolte port, který přibyl po připojení zařízení!
      (Musíte mít nainstalovaný Arduino USB driver!)
  6. Volba programátoru:
    • Nástroje → Programátor → USB tiny ISP

Problém: Nefunguje převodník USB2.0-Serial

Problém
Řešení?

Zdroje

Osobní nástroje
Jmenné prostory
Varianty
Akce
Výuka
Navigace
Nástroje